Maglovac
Maglovac is a hill in Opština Aranđelovac, Šumadija District, Central Serbia and has an elevation of 197 metres. Maglovac is situated nearby to the village Venčane, as well as near Tulež.Places in the Area

Venčane
Village

Venčane is a village in the municipality of Aranđelovac, Serbia. According to the 2002 census, the village has a population of 1576 people.
Tulež
Village
Tulež is a village in the municipality of Aranđelovac, Serbia. According to the 2002 census, the village has a population of 761 people. According to the 2022 census, it has 584 inhabitants. Tulež is situated 3 km west of Maglovac.
Drlupa
Village
Drlupa is a village in the municipality of Sopot, Serbia. According to the 2022 census, the village has a population of 458 people. Drlupa is situated 3½ km northeast of Maglovac.
